引言
随着网络技术的飞速发展,网络安全问题日益突出。渗透测试作为网络安全领域的重要手段,旨在发现和修复潜在的安全漏洞,保障网络系统的安全稳定运行。本文将深入探讨渗透测试的相关知识,从入门到精通,并结合实战培训课程,帮助读者驾驭网络安全挑战。
一、渗透测试概述
1.1 渗透测试的定义
渗透测试(Penetration Testing),又称渗透攻击,是一种模拟黑客攻击的方法,通过合法手段对目标系统进行安全漏洞的发现和利用,从而评估系统的安全性。
1.2 渗透测试的目的
- 发现系统中的安全漏洞,评估系统的安全性;
- 提高系统管理员的安全意识,加强安全防护措施;
- 为企业或组织提供专业的安全评估报告,降低安全风险。
二、渗透测试入门
2.1 渗透测试工具
- Nmap:网络扫描工具,用于发现目标系统中的开放端口和运行的服务;
- Burp Suite:Web应用安全测试工具,用于检测Web应用中的安全漏洞;
- Metasploit:漏洞利用工具,用于利用已知漏洞攻击目标系统;
- Wireshark:网络协议分析工具,用于捕获和分析网络数据包。
2.2 渗透测试流程
- 信息收集:收集目标系统的相关信息,包括IP地址、域名、开放端口、运行的服务等;
- 漏洞扫描:使用渗透测试工具对目标系统进行漏洞扫描,发现潜在的安全漏洞;
- 漏洞利用:针对发现的漏洞进行利用,验证漏洞的真实性和影响程度;
- 安全加固:根据渗透测试结果,提出安全加固建议,提高目标系统的安全性。
三、渗透测试实战培训课程
3.1 课程内容
- 渗透测试基础理论;
- 常用渗透测试工具的使用;
- 渗透测试实战案例分析;
- 渗透测试报告撰写技巧;
- 安全加固策略与最佳实践。
3.2 课程特点
- 实战性强:课程结合实际案例,让学员在实战中学习渗透测试技能;
- 案例丰富:涵盖多种类型的渗透测试案例,满足不同层次学员的需求;
- 专业师资:由具有丰富实战经验的渗透测试专家授课;
- 互动性强:学员与讲师互动交流,解决实际问题。
四、总结
渗透测试是网络安全领域的重要手段,掌握渗透测试技能对于保障网络安全具有重要意义。通过本文的介绍,相信读者对渗透测试有了更深入的了解。参加实战培训课程,可以系统地学习渗透测试知识,提高自己的网络安全技能,为应对网络安全挑战做好准备。
